Home Workouts vs. Gym Workouts: Pros and Cons You Need to Know

  When it comes to fitness, one of the most debated topics is whether home workouts or gym workouts are more effective. Both have their unique benefits and drawbacks, and the best choice often depends on individual preferences, goals, and circumstances. In this article, we’ll dive into the pros and cons of each option to help you make an informed decision. Home Workouts: The Pros 1. Convenience and Flexibility • No Commute: One of the most significant advantages of working out at home is the elimination of travel time. This convenience makes it easier to fit workouts into a busy schedule. • Anytime Fitness: You can exercise at any time of the day, whether it’s early in the morning, during lunch breaks, or late at night. This flexibility can help maintain a consistent workout routine. 2. Cost-Effective • No Membership Fees: Gym memberships can be expensive. Mindfulness Meditation: How to Do It

Mindfulness Meditation: How to do it    Introduction In the fast-paced world we live in, the practice of mindfulness meditation has gained significant popularity for its profound impact on mental well-being. This article will delve into three powerful mindfulness meditation techniques – breath awareness, body scan, and loving-kindness meditation . By the end of this guide, you'll have a comprehensive understanding of each technique and how to incorporate them into your daily routine for a more mindful and fulfilling life . 1. Breath Awareness Meditation:-  Start by finding a quiet space where you can sit comfortably. Close your eyes and bring your attention to your breath. Focus on the natural rhythm of your breathing, paying close attention to the sensation of the breath entering and leaving your body. When your mind wanders, gently guide it back to the breath.
